一、引言高中《物理》第二册“磁场”一章中,电流产生磁场是个重点.教材对此安排了一个奥斯特实验,如图1所示.这个实验可以证实电流周围有磁场存在,但还有另外几个问题:1.磁场方向往往要受到地磁场力的影响,不能完全由磁针N极的指向反映出电流磁场的方向.2.磁针水平转动可见度小,学生不易观察.3.实验无法帮助学生进行电流周围的磁感强度
